' 3 : weekend sports Heels at Pitt; Unranked Carolina and No. 9 Pittsburgh face off at 1:30 p.m. Saturday afternoon in a game televised regionally by ABC-TV (Channel 5). ' Keith Jackson and Frank Broyles, athletic director and former head football coach at Arkansas, will provide commentary. Carolina is 1-1, having defeated East Carolina 14-10 two weeks ago before losing 21-20 to Maryland last week. Pitt is 2-0 with a 24-6 win over Tulane and a 20-12 victory over Temple. The Panthers are led by 6-foot-2, 215 pound sophomore defensive end Hugh Green and 6-foot, 180-pound, senior split end Gordon Jones. soccer home The Panthers are coached by Jackie Sherrill, who is in his second year. Pitt won the 1976 national championship under Johnny Majors. Carolina's soccer and men's and women's cross country teams are in action at home this weekend. The soccer team will meet Virginia at 2 p.m. Saturday on Fetzet, Field in ah ACC match. The women's cross country team will compete against Maryland and Wake Forest beginning at 10 a.m. Saturday at Finley Golf Course.
